The Italian Alps are part of the mountain range Alps,
located in Italy. The scenery of this part is really beautiful. They
create a natural link between Mediterranean Sea and central Europe. South
Tyrol Alps has rich history and marks there are left by Bavarian
farmers as well as by European royalty. There are about 300 lakes of glaciers in Trentino. This area is a paradise for experienced hikers. But also other sports lovers will find something for them..for example Lake Garda is ideal for swimming, windsurfing, fishing, sailing, yachting or canoeing. Even well known thinkers and writers like Thomas Mann, Sigmund Freud or Goethe were attracted by this place. These days most visitors come for their Italian Alps vacations to enjoy golf, tennis, paragliding, mountain biking or horseback riding. Not to forge a night life: pubs, discos, live music. There are plenty of hotels, chalets, rentals or other types of accommodations available. And not to forget, famous italian cuisine with excellent italian food and wine. Visitors can choose from many restaurants. Popular Places: Bolzano is the city with ancient castles and insights of history of Dolomites. Its ancient trading town is today distinguished by shopping street, colorful markets or gourmet shops. Val Gardena is a place where kings and emperors used to retreat during summer. Visitors can even have cooking lessons to master gastronomy of this region. Probably Cortina dŽAmpezzo is more know thanks to its ski resort, but also those who comes for summer vacations have a lot of interesting possibilities. Historic hiking trails to Dinosaurs route or the Iron route and to the mediaval Castle of Andraz. More
to the west is Aosta Valley with four highest mountains of Europe
(Mont Blanc, Monte Rosa, Gran Paradiso and the Matterhorn). There is a
french cultural influence with traditional parades and carnivals. The Piedmont Region is well know for Turin (its capital) with splendid architecture or cuisine. Recently for hosting XX Olympic games. The Lombardy region Lake Como, north of Milan stretches from Lugano for 50 miles to the Bergamo Alps. But for many the most beautiful lake is Lake Maggiore which is sheltered by an Alpine ring. Magical blue waters are surrounded by green hills that grows to mysterious Val Grande. All this and more is making Italian Alps very popular holiday destination.
